Rock Cottage Cornwall is a 16c Cornish property which sits completely alone in AONB enjoying an acre of private grounds, including a riverside woodland which leads to a jetty and private foreshore where our rowing dinghy 'Peggy' is moored. The large terraced garden hugs the two borders of the spectacular and ever-changing view of the Mawgan Creek of the Helford River. This is exclusive to guests! Abundant water fowl and garden birds too; fishing, kayaking, rowing, sailing, paddle boarding as well as wild swimming are all possible from Rock Cottage. You are welcome to bring kayaks, canoes with you and launch/store these on our jetty.

This well appointed 'home away from home' has all you need for a relaxing and comfortable stay and with full central heating by radiators, Rock Cottage is welcoming whatever the season.

The kitchen/diner has a picturesque view of the garden, river, surrounding fields and sessile oak woodland. It is fully equipped with a new AEG steam oven and washer/dryer, Smeg ceramic hob, 60/40 LEC fridge/freezer, Bosch dishwasher and a Panasonic microwave oven. On the ground floor of the cottage, is the newly renovated bathroom. This is beautifully tiled with underfloor electric heating, an electric shower over a large bath, toilet and a built-in wash hand basin. This room also serves the Garden room guests.

Step into the fully carpeted and beamed lounge with its thick and original cob walls. There are two cushioned window seats, quirky walls and alcoves, a copper canopied inglenook housing an electric wood burner, modern and most comfortable soft furnishings, an oak sideboard, table and chairs complete with wall lighting and ship's lantern. For entertainment there is an ipod dock music system, LED Smart TV, DVD player, stacks of games and puzzles as well as a great selection of Cornish novels, including many books relating to Cornish culture and maps to help you plan your outings.

At the far end of the lounge is the open tread wooden staircase. This has a short wall-mounted handrail and leads to the landing, children's and master bedrooms. These two rooms have a fabulous view of the river, are well furnished, comfortable and have top quality mattresses with fine bed linen.

Ten paces from the front door is the fully carpeted Garden room. This is set up for adults or teenagers only. It is arranged with two single beds which can be zip and linked to form a fabulous 6ft, when a couple sleep in here and by request. You will wake up to a marvellous view from this room which is complimented with white New England style furniture and a 40" wall mounted TV.

On the patio is a large benched picnic table and for the summer months, a sun parasol, drinks table and reclining chairs are provided. There are two other benches placed around the large garden for you to enjoy a different aspect.

'Peggy' is available from Easter until late October and is 3.5M long and ideal for four persons. We supply lifejackets in various sizes, crabbing lines for children as well as a Tide Table to plan your activities.

Our rates are fully inclusive of bed linen, towels (beach not provided), tea towels, bath mats, BT superfast fibre broadband (wifi), heating oil, electricity, luxury toiletries, boat and life jackets. For a baby we can supply a cot, highchair, baby bath and changing mat for a small supplement.

Master Bedroom - One king size bed (5ft)
Children's Bedroom - Two single beds (2ft 6" wide)
Garden Room - Two single beds (3ft wide) can be linked to form a super king sized bed.

Within the village of Mawgan is a shop, church and The Ship Inn pub with restaurant. By foot it is no more than fifteen minutes. If you venture in the opposite direction towards St Martin, you can visit Gear Farm pasty shop, the Prince of Wales and further on the Gwella Dairy for their homemade ice cream. Helford village is a short drive away where you can take a boat ferry across the water.

The location makes it easy to explore the Lizard Peninsula including the wonderful Kynance Cove. Sandy beaches, quaint fishing coves, coastal path walks, pubs, restaurants, art galleries, numerous gardens, tin mines, museums, boat and fishing trips are all accessible. At nearby Gweek is the Seal Sanctuary and Helston Town is only 10 minutes by car.

What a fantastic property, I cannot recommend Rock Cottage highly enough! We had the most wonderful week here - everything written about it is 100% true but it's so much more than that. Firstly, the cottage's location is ideal - despite being a very short drive/walk away from Mawgan village, the cottage itself is fantastically private and there's literally nobody in sight in any direction. It has, without question, the best view possible of the tidal river and the wonderfully gnarly trees that line it - we were mesmerised, no matter the time or the weather. The avid bird watcher among us was similarly thrilled by the fabulous variety of feathered friends that were continually present. Secondly, the cottage itself is beautiful. It's in excellent condition and fabulously maintained. We were especially touched by the thoughtfulness of the welcoming scones, cream, home-made bread and many more treats that awaited us after a long journey to Cornwall - thank you so much Linda! Everything we needed was there and in addition there was plenty of space for all of our fulsome paraphernalia. The kitchen's vista is incredible and we spent a great deal of our time there, it really is the heart of the house. Every room in the house is just great, but the Garden Room in particular is also gorgeous and it too has the most spectacular view. Indeed, its being separate from the main cottage made it an ideal retreat for the 13-year old in our party! Finally, the privacy of the cottage really is its selling point for us. There's a great deal of land attached to Rock Cottage, which is so much fun to explore. The main part of the garden is on a significant slope, but the very manageable steps, the charming stepping stones, the different levels, the well-placed benches, the fantastic jetty and the excitement of the neighbouring wood make it an outdoor wonderland. Being able to use Peggy the rowing boat was such a bonus, as was the crabbing equipment. Wetsuits are highly recommended when swimming, but this is true of all British waterways! Also, wellies are essential because of the mud when the tide is out. There is no downside to Rock Cottage whatsoever - it's wonderful. The tides mean there's a limit on how much time you're able to spend in the water. Happily, however, the mud flats are gorgeous to look at and the plethora of stunning Cornish beaches are about 20 minutes' drive away, depending on which direction you choose.
